- Lister has been spending at lot of time in an artificial reality gaming system, Kryten visits him in one game requesting him to leave, Starbug has entered simulant territory and the ship has to shut down and go into silent running. A simulant cruiser intercepts them and the captain wishes to speak to them, simulants are misanthropic so speaking directly could be problematic, Lister and Cat communicate in disguise as aliens, Kryten filming their mouths upside down with his false eyes on stuck to their chins. The simulant captain teleports onto Starbug and is disappointed with the crew, two humans, a humanoid and a mechanical servant, he shoots them all.
The crew wake up on Starbug all having been put under for three weeks, the simulants upgraded their ship, even adding weapons. This was to challenge them in a fair fight. The battle begins and the Dwarfers score a lucky shot on the cruiser starting a meltdown, the second-in-command infects Starbug's navigation computer with the Armageddon virus before the cruiser is destroyed. Starbug's controls are unresponsive and their locked on a collision course with a lava moon due in half an hour. Kryten uploads the virus to his CPU to study it and create an antidote named a Dove program.
Kryten is wired up to a life monitor where he's losing to the virus, the others view the battle on a screen, it takes the form of a Wild-West story with Kryten playing the role of a failing Sheriff, he's confronted by an outlaw gang known as the Apocalypse boys, Death, resembling the simulant captain, War, Famine and Pestilence. Kryten has only one hour to leave town.
The others hook up into the dream via the artificial reality machine, they take the role of Western heroes, Rimmer as Dangerous Dan McGrew, a bare-handed fighting specialist, Cat as Riviera Kid, ace gunslinger and Lister as Brett Riverboat, knife thrower. The enter the simulation and head to the local saloon, they order some drinks which Rimmer can't keep down and he vomits into the hat of a burly customer, Lister offers money as compensation. Kryten walks in and hands his belongings to the barmaid for a bottle of Whiskey. The others speak with him but he has no memory of them, a customer steals Kryten's bottle with a whip which Lister retrieves with his knives, and then pins said customer to the wall with the knives. Two gunmen fire at them and Cat shoots their bullets out of the air, Kryten makes to leave and the others pursue, Rimmer holds off an attack by himself with his combat skills. Cat stops Kryten's escape with a trick shot making a sign fall on him.
Kryten is taken back to the saloon and fed bowls of raw coffee until sober, Cat has retrieved Kryten's guns, a pair of revolvers with doves carved on the handles and no bullet chambers, Kryten begins to remember a few things, such as minor details of his crew mates, the Apocalypse boys arrive and the Dwarfers go out face them, Death spreads the virus into the A.R. machine removing the Dwarfers abilities. They have to get out, the emergency exit, a button in the palm of the A.R. glove doesn't work, so they get their real world selves to force off the helmets. Once out Kryten has enough time to finish the antidote, drawing his guns which turn into doves that erase the Apocalypse boys.
Kryten is awake in the real world with the antidote, there's only two minutes to impact, Kryten uploads the antidote, Starbug goes into the lava for a few seconds and then reemerges, the Dwarfers give a triumphant rebel yell and fly off into the sunset.
